人工智能语音合成技术的实现原理

人工智能语音合成技术的实现原理
随着科技的发展,人工智能技术日益成熟,其中语音合成技术就是其中之一。现在越来越多的智能设备都支持语音输入、语音交互甚至语音控制,实现这些功能的背后就是人工智能语音合成技术。那么,人工智能语音合成技术是如何实现的呢?
语音合成技术的主要目的是将文字转化为语音,实现与人类自然语言的交互。要实现这一目的,需要依靠计算机语音合成技术,这是一种利用计算机将文字转化为语音的技术。
语音合成技术可以分为规则型语音合成和基于机器学习的语音合成两种方法。三星i339
中国导医网规则型语音合成是依据声音和语音的基本规律,通过人工编制语音合成规则,用计算机程序模拟讲话人的发音特点和语言习惯,来生成人类自然语言发音。这种方法的执行效率较高,但是需要很多人工参与,且效果不如基于机器学习的语音合成。
吴越春秋史话
基于机器学习的语音合成技术是利用机器学习的方法,将大量语音数据和文本数据进行训练,进而生成语音合成模型,并使用模型对文本进行语音合成。这种技术利用了深度学习等技术,可以自动化训练模型,减少人工参与,且语音合成效果更加自然。
曝斯坦福校长学术不端
在基于机器学习的语音合成中,使用的是序列到序列模型,也就是将一个序列映射到另一个序列。首先,将文本数据转换为语音特征,即将文本转换为语音,然后,通过DNN模型进行建模,得到最终的语音输出。
沈阳营销语音合成中,主要分为两个模块:前端和后端。前端模块的主要职责是将文本转换为声学特征,包括音素分割、音素转换、声调转换等;后端模块的主要任务是通过DNN等模型对声学特征进行建模,生成最终的语音输出。
前端模块中最重要的技术包括TTS文本分析、TTS语音分析和TTS文本驱动的声音生成。TTS文本分析主要是对输入的文本进行分析,将其分成音素、韵律和语调等单元,使之可以被后续TTS语音分析等步骤处理;TTS语音分析主要是将语音分解成声调等单元,以便后续处理;TTS文本驱动的声音生成重要的是将文本转化为声学特征。
后端模块主要包括声学模型和声学后处理等部分。在声学模型中,主要就是通过DNN等模型进行训练,得到最终的语音输出。而在声学后处理中,主要是对DNN输出的语音进行处理,使得最终的语音输出更加自然,例如去除噪音、增加语音的韵律等。
魏雨琦
总之,人工智能语音合成技术是现代技术的重要成果之一,也是实现智能交互的基础。语音合成技术的实现依靠规则型语音合成和基于机器学习的语音合成两种方法,其中基于机器学习的方法更为流行,根据序列到序列模型的原理,通过DNN等模型实现对声学特征的建模,生成最终的语音输出,从而实现了给文本语音化的功能。

本文发布于:2024-09-22 05:37:15,感谢您对本站的认可!

本文链接:https://www.17tex.com/xueshu/247730.html

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。

下一篇:声级计知识
标签:语音   合成   技术   文本   模型   实现   声学
留言与评论(共有 0 条评论)
   
验证码:
Copyright ©2019-2024 Comsenz Inc.Powered by © 易纺专利技术学习网 豫ICP备2022007602号 豫公网安备41160202000603 站长QQ:729038198 关于我们 投诉建议